STRATEGY OF SPAСE DEBRIS TREATMENT
Journal Title: Вісник Національного Авіаційного Університету - Year 2018, Vol 74, Issue 1
Abstract
Purpose and Objectives of the Work: this scientific article is devoted to space debris management issues. The aim of this scientific investigati on is assessment of the protection methods from the influence of space debris on the Earth. Methods of Research: ground-based measurements, space-based measurements, analysis of the protection strategies. Research Results: providing of two protection strategies: shielding (space debris shields for both manned and unmanne d spacecraft can be quite effective against small particles. Protection against particles 0.1-1 cm in size can be achieved by shielding spacecraft structures) and collision avoidance which is possible by reducing th e amount of new debris created and, in the longer term, removing existing debris. Discussion: to improve the space environment we need to develop the complex approach, which, first of all, must include : 1) reducing creation of debris; 2) removing existing debris.
